Imam Ibn Sirin

Ibn Seerin's Dictionary of Dreams (Al-Akili tr.) · p. 232

In a dream, jasmine denotes happiness, blessings and benefits. It also represents religious scholars and spiritual teachers. If one sees heavenly angels descending from the heavens to pick jasmine flowers in a dream, it means the death of scholars. Jasmine in a dream also means despair, or making a false oath. It also could mean dispelling anxieties, distress and adversities. As for a bachelor, jasmine in a dream means getting married. Seeing a jasmine flower in one's hand in a dream also means recovering from a chest cold or a fever.

Al-Bakri Al-Qafsi

Interpretations of Dreams (Ibn Raashid Al-Bakri Al-Qafsi, Darussalam tr.) · p. 195

Shaykh Shihaab - ud - Deen said: The word Yasmeen (jasmine) iscomposed o f Ya ' s (despair) and Mayn (lie, falsehood). If a person asksfor something in his dream and is given jasmine, his need will not bemet. In my opinion, if he asked for something and despaired of it, thensees jasmine in his dream, he will get what he was hopin g for, becausedespairing of a lie leads to hope.
